Smart Keys
Smart keys are an important advance in the technology of car keys. They utilize Bluetooth-based technology to unlock and start vehicles without the need for physical keys. They also have sensors microchips, microchips, and rolling security codes to increase security. The code is changed each time the driver opens a trunk or door which makes it more difficult for thieves.
The new digital key available for the Hyundai Sonata and Kia K5 models, is an example of a smart key. It can be used to lock and unlock vehicles remotely. Compatible with certain smartphones as well, it can be used as a key. This feature is especially beneficial when a driver has lost their keys or is unable to locate the keys.
Smart keys can also be programmed with car settings, such as the position of the seat, steering wheel, exterior mirror settings and stereo presets. This feature is particularly useful for drivers who operate multiple vehicles since they can quickly return to their car with the settings they like best.
There are concerns about the security features of a smart-key. Some people worry that if someone steals a key fob, they can use it to gain entry into the vehicle and then escape with it. This isn't a problem yet but it's something that could happen in the near future. You should always lock your smart key in a safe location when it's not in use to minimize the risk.
A smart key could also be stolen or lost. If this happens, you may not be able to unlock and start your car and you may need to contact a locksmith for help. There are ways to prevent this, like using a Faraday pouch or a signal blocker. You can also upgrade your software, as auto makers issue regular updates to fix security problems.
In addition, most smart keys have an alternative method of opening and starting your car in the event that the battery is depleted. Emergency opening can be achieved by placing the dead key in the slot or putting it in a specific part of the cockpit, where there is an inductive coil that could transfer energy to the dead key fob.

Transponder keys
Hyundai is a leading automaker around the globe and their vehicles are designed using the latest technology. These advancements can cause issues, particularly when key fobs and other components fail to function properly. Hyundai drivers can discover a variety of solutions to address these issues and [Redirect Only] get back on the road.
Contrary to traditional mechanical keys modern Hyundai key fobs have a microchip within the plastic head that connects to the vehicle's security system. When the key is inserted or placed near the ignition, the chip sends a signal that matches the serial number that is stored in the car's system. If the match is successful, the engine begins. If, however, the key isn't valid, the engine will not start and the security system will inform you that the key is not functioning properly.
The biggest issue with these keys is that they may be rendered inoperable if the battery goes out. In this instance the best way to fix it is to replace the battery. The majority of models use CR2032 battery, which is readily available in electronics stores. The process is simple, but you will have to remove the fob to replace it. You can use a screwdriver with a flat head to break the fob and then locate the battery and replace it.
Transponder keys can be costly, but they have many benefits which make it worthwhile. They are harder to duplicate and work with the immobilizer system, which helps prevent theft. These keys are a great choice for those who wish to protect their luxury cars or their family rigs from thieves.
